Project Recipe
Cut cardstock and designer paper pieces to the following sizes using a Stampin' Trimmer:
- card from Old Olive Cardstock at 5-1/2" x 8-1/2" and scored at 4-1/4"
- 4" x 5-1/4" from Shaded Spruce Cardstock
- 2" x 5" of light green and dark green plaid design from Under the Mistletoe Designer Series Paper
- 2-7/8" x 4" from Old Olive Cardstock
- 2-5/8" x 3-3/4" from Early Espresso Cardstock
- 2-1/2" x 3-5/8" from Very Vanilla Cardstock
- 1-1/2" square from Very Vanilla Cardstock
Place the Buffalo Check background stamp rubber side up on Grid Paper on your work surface . Ink up the stamp by pouncing or rubbing the Shaded Spruce Ink Pad all over it. Leave the inked up stamp face up on your work surface. Carefully place the Shaded Spruce rectangle on the stamp. Fold the Grid Paper up and over the top of everything and rub firmly all over. Using the Grid Paper protects your hands from getting ink on them.
Tip: I just clean my background stamps by running them under water until the water runs clear. Then, I let them air dry.
Adhere the stamped Shaded Spruce rectangle to the front of the Old Olive card.
Adhere the Old Olive rectangle to the front of the card so it is even with the top and bottom of the stamped Shaded Spruce layer and about 1/2" in from the left side of the card.
Unlock the Banner Triple Punch. Slide one end of the strip of Under the Mistletoe Designer Paper into the punch as far as it will go. Punch.
Adhere the punched strip of the designer paper to the center of the card front so the notch is on the right and the left, flat edge is even with the left edge of the Shaded Spruce layer.
Carefully remove a magnet from the back of the Stamparatus and place it on your work surface. Place the Stamparatus in front of you with the open sides of the Stamparatus on the left and bottom. Insert one of the plates into the hinges on the right side of the Stamparatus.
Place the large vanilla rectangle somewhere on the base of the Stamparatus so the top of the rectangle is against the top of the base. Use the magnet to hold the cardstock in place. Position the cypress tree stamp from the Rooted In Nature Set on the vanilla rectangle so the stamp is image side down centered on the rectangle from side to side and as close to the top as possible. Close the plate onto the stamp and press firmly to make sure it is stuck to the plate.
As you prepare to ink up the stamp on the Stamparatus plate each time, place the stamp case under the Stamparatus plate to give it some firmness as you ink up the stamp.
If you have a Stampin' Spot in the color you want to stamp with, then use it to ink up the stamp each time. This will help avoid getting ink on the plate where you don't want it.
If you do get ink on the plate, then wipe it off with a baby wipe, tissue, or paper towel before closing the plate to stamp to avoid getting excess ink on your project piece where you don't want it.
Ink up the top portion of the stamp only (the leaves) using the Old Olive Ink Pad. Close the plate onto the vanilla rectangle and press down firmly. Open the plate.
Use the Early Espresso Marker to color in the trunk of the tree image where it shows through the leaves and under the leaves. Close the plate onto the vanilla rectangle and press down firmly. Open the plate.
Use the brush tip of the Shaded Spruce Marker to randomly thump lines of dark green all around on the leaves of the tree image. Close the plate onto the vanilla rectangle and press down firmly. Open the plate.
Remove the stamped vanilla rectangle from the Stamparatus and adhere it to the Early Espresso rectangle. Then, adhere it to the front of the card so it is centered in the strip of Old Olive.
Mount the "Be strong. Be happy. Be you." sentiment from the Rooted In Nature Set on Block B. Ink it up with the Old Olive Ink Pad. Stamp it in the center of the small square of Very Vanilla Cardstock.
Use Paper Snips to carefully cut out each of the sentiment strips.
Use Mini Glue Dots (squish in the edges) to adhere the sentiment strips to the base of the tree image rectangle at differing angles.
Pick out a button from the Galvanized Buttons. Use a Mini Glue Dot to adhere it to the card front on the bottom right side of the main image where it overlaps the designer paper banner.
Cut a 3" piece of 3/16" Braided Linen Trim. Tie a half knot in the center. Fray the ends. Trim the ends. Adhere the knot to the top of the button using a Mini Glue Dot.
